摘要:
Algorithms based on biasing data entering a square law terminal error penalty function are synthesized for the optimal control problem with terminal restraints at a fixed time. A development leads to basic, interpolative, and control compensated-bias updating strategies with progressively improved performance compared with existing methods demonstrated from computational results. The new algorithms are related to existing methods based on penalty weight updating, the modified method of multipliers, adjoint system and isoperimetric formulations.
